Alan Ray Bollinger passed away on November 7, 2023, surrounded by family. Alan was born on May 6, 1965, to Linda (Tinker) and Ivan Bollinger. He was a twin to Kelly Bollinger and brother to Debbie Bollinger (Kentch). Alan graduated from Walla Walla High School in 1984 and became a loyal and dedicated employee for 40 years at Loney's Harvest Foods and, later on, Walla Walla's Harvest Foods. Alan truly enjoyed the people he met during his employment here. While employed at Loney's, he met his wife, Mary, whom he married on September 21, 1996. Alan welcomed his daughter, Destinee, in August 1997 and his son, Tanner, in May 2001.
Alan's "other baby" (his Silverwing Motorcycle) was one of his pride and joys, and he could be seen riding around town in his free time. Alan loved his motorcycle and the people he rode with and that he met along the way. Alan was a lifelong San Francisco 49ers fan and could be heard cheering them on from any room in the house (or the neighbor's house). Wherever you were, you knew where he was because of his very distinct laugh that could put a smile on anybody's face and add a little light into a rough day. Alan was an animal lover; he enjoyed every one of the pets that his children brought home, from rabbits to cats, to guinea pigs, to chickens (what a circus), and, of course, dogs! He loved them like they were members of the family (because they were). Most recently, Alan was the one to bring home a sweet black lab puppy. Alan loved that puppy for the rest of his life.
Alan enjoyed camping, spending time with family, and loved collecting rocks and gems.
Alan is survived by his wife, Mary; his daughter, Destinee of Walla Walla; son, Tanner of College Place; mother, Linda Tinker of Walla Walla; sister, Debbie Bollinger Kentch (Roger) of Touchet; brother, Kelly Bollinger of Walla Walla; and multiple nieces and nephews, and great nieces and nephews of surrounding areas.
He is preceded in death by his father, Ivan Bollinger; his grandmother and grandfather, Juanita and Vernon Strode; and his aunt, Patricia Clapp.
A Celebration of Life will be held at a later date, and all are welcome.
